**Ticket: Catalogue import config drifted again**

Welcome aboard! Quick one for whoever picks this up. The Brindlewood library catalogue importer on staging is running with different batch sizes than prod, so imports that pass staging keep timing out live. Nobody updated the template after last month's hotfix. To fix it properly, replace the staging file with the values below.

config for haweg-bagag:
[kasath]
host = kasath.qirvancorp.internal
user = kasath_svc
database = kasath_prod

Subject: Handover — Larkspur API releases

Hi all — passing the Larkspur release duties along. Note carefully: the v6 pagination change (cursor-based, replacing offsets) means every public release must include the migration shim until Q3, or external integrations break silently. Always run the contract tests before tagging. The publish step requires signing the release bundle; I've verified the key is current as of today. It is included below.

deploy key for kahof-tadup: bky4_rRMZ

## Add batched validation to CSV import wizard

This PR reworks the Tidewren import wizard so rows are validated in batches instead of one at a time. Previously, large uploads from Hollis & Marrow clients timed out at the parsing step. Now the wizard streams the file, validates chunks, and reports errors per batch with row offsets. Nothing changes in the mapping UI. If you're onboarding, start with `importer/pipeline.go`; the rest is plumbing. Batch sizes and timeouts are controlled by the constants below.

tuning constants:
QUOTAS = {
    "druwyn": 5,
    "holix": 5,
    "zorath": 5,
    "holwyn": 10,
}

Ticket: Missed pick-up — signed contracts

To: Warehouse shift lead, Dovercliff depot

Courier from Ashgate Runners no-showed Monday for the contract pouch going from the Dovercliff depot to the Harlowe Street office. Pouch contains signed Tresmont lease agreements — originals, no copies exist off-site. Pouch is sealed, logged, and locked in the dispatch cage, slot 4. New run booked for Wednesday, 10:00 window. Do not release to anyone without verifying against the dispatch sheet. Hold all questions for the office. Hand-over instruction below.

dispatch memo: the eliok quenok courier leaves the sorael aldath belion tammir casix gileth queniel jorath ledger at gate 9299 under passcode 897989